一、功能测试点 sdk授权登录、充值通用
正常测试流程
多次登陆正常
- Android(不同版本\机型) IOS(不同版本\机型)
- sdk兼容测试(重点放在异形屏、刘海屏)
- 拉取的界面无异常
登陆测试
- 没有安装授权软件(微信、qq)的时候不能弹出一键授权登录
- 友好提示请先安装xxx
- 可以扫码登录
自动登陆
token有效期过期测试
退出测试,拉去sdk后退出,手机按键退出
切换账号测试
挤号登陆测试
- A端拉取sdk支付界面,B端挤号进入
异常测试流程
弱网测试(极差网络等各弱网条件下的登陆)
无网测试(无网络情况下登陆,提示和界面是否友好和正确)
断线重连(登陆过程中进行断线重连)
- 重点:弱网情况下一定要严格测试充值业务!! 充值过程的异常操作(充值之后不点击确实杀进程。。。)
二、兼容性测试点
第一次接入sdk后,需要做兼容性测试。
覆盖安卓和Ios的所有系统版本。
三、安全性测试点
- 手机本地不存储敏感数据
- 手机清缓存和数据后,登陆流程正常
- 手机权限申请无使用不到的权限,无敏感权限
- 在拒绝一些权限申请后,app内中需要使用时,询问权限申请